Stretch with Intention and Awareness

Stretching is not just about reaching for your toes; it's a practice that requires intention and awareness to benefit your body and mind fully. Whether you're a seasoned yogi or a beginner looking to improve flexibility, incorporating mindfulness into your stretching routine can enhance the overall experience.

The Importance of Mindful Stretching

Mindful stretching involves being present in the moment, focusing on the sensations in your body, and moving with awareness. This approach can help prevent injuries, improve flexibility, and promote relaxation.

Tips for Stretching with Intention

  1. Breathe deeply: Use your breath to guide your movements and deepen your stretches.
  2. Focus on the sensation: Notice how each stretch feels and adjust accordingly to avoid pain.
  3. Set an intention: Whether it's to release tension or increase flexibility, have a clear goal in mind.
  4. Move mindfully: Slow down your movements and pay attention to your body's signals.

Stretching for Flexibility

Flexibility is not only beneficial for athletes but for everyone looking to move with ease and prevent muscle stiffness. Regular stretching can improve your range of motion and overall quality of life.

Best Stretches for Flexibility

  • Hamstring Stretch: Sit on the floor with one leg extended and lean forward from your hips.
  • Quadriceps Stretch: Stand on one leg, bend your knee, and bring your foot towards your glutes.
  • Shoulder Stretch: Reach one arm across your body and gently press it with your other hand.
  • Spinal Twist: Sit tall, twist your upper body to one side, and hold the stretch.

Remember, consistency is key when it comes to improving flexibility. Listen to your body, respect your limits, and enjoy the journey of becoming more flexible and mindful through stretching.
